The About:Blank virus may increase your computer's boot time.

About:Blank pop-ups are generated by the About:Blank virus. In addition to flooding your computer with pop-ups, the About:Blank virus changes your Internet homepage and redirects your Internet searches to international and pornographic websites that may contain additional malware. Finally, the About:Blank virus may slow your computer, reduce your available virtual memory and cause your computer to freeze or restart. Fortunately, you can put an end to the unsolicited pop-ups and other problems by removing the About:Blank virus.

Instructions

  1. End Processes

    • 1

      Press "Ctrl," "Shift" and "Escape" simultaneously to open the Task Manager.

    • 2

      Click the "Processes" tab.

    • 3

      End each of the following processes listed under the "Image Name" heading. To end a process, right-click the process and select "End Process."

      phafxfa.exe

      svhost.exe

      smbdins.exe

      sethcd.exe

      tsmsetup.exe

    • 4

      Close the Task Manager.

    Delete Registry Entries

    • 5

      Click "Start," type "regedit" into the search field and press "Enter." The Registry Editor opens.

    • 6

      Delete each of the following registry entries from the left pane of the Registry Editor. To delete a registry entry, right-click the entry and select "Delete."

      H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INEsoftwaremicrosoftinternet explorertoolbar {06abaa2d-34ab-4902-a326-409bd9b9a7a5}

      H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INEsoftwaremicrosoftwindowscurrentversionexplorerbrowser helper objects{b664647f-efd5-4837-a810-a807139107e5}

      H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INEsoftwaremicrosoftwindowscurrentversionrun network service

      HKEY_CLASSES_ROOTclsid{06abaa2d-34ab-4902-a326-409bd9b9a7a5}

      HKEY_CLASSES_ROOTclsid{b664647f-efd5-4837-a810-a807139107e5}

      HKEY_CLASSES_ROOTclsid{ce6a1268-9cc9-4ba3-8657-fe1132906cc4}

      HKEY_CURRENT_USERsoftwaremicrosoftinternet explorertoolbarwebbrowser {06abaa2d-34ab-4902-a326-409bd9b9a7a5}

      HKEY_CURRENT_USERsoftwaremicrosoftwindowscurrentversionrun network service

    • 7

      Close the Registry Editor.

    Delete DLL's And Files

    • 8

      Click "Start," type "cmd" into the search field and press "Enter." The Command Prompt opens.

    • 9

      Type the following commands into the Command Prompt. Press "Enter" after each command.

      regsvr32 /u wdm.dll

      regsvr32 /u achpjba.dll

      regsvr32 /u cbme.dll

      regsvr32 /u se.dll

      regsvr32 /u iesp1.dll

      del ld[X].tmp

      del syg.db

      del spyfalcon.URL

      del blacklist.txt

      del english.ini

      del spyfalcon 2.0.lnk

      del uninstall spyfalcon 2.0.lnk

      del spyfalcon 2.0.lnk

      del spyfalcon 2.0 website.lnk

      del spyfalcon.lnk

      del spyfalcon 2.0.lnk

    • 10

      Close the Command Prompt and restart your computer.

Tips & Warnings

  • Malicious programs, including the About:Blank virus, can sometimes be removed by anti-malware programs. Not all anti-malware programs are created equal and thus some may be able to remove the virus where others will not. The Windows Vista and 7 operating systems come pre-installed with Windows Defender, a free anti-malware program. To run Windows Defender, click "Start," "All Programs" and "Windows Defender." Then click the "Down Arrow" next to Scan and select "Full Scan."
